Instructions

Step 1

Miss World is considered one of the most prestigious beauty contests. To earn the right to participate, the future contestant must win a national beauty contest. Before that, she needs to win a regional competition.

Step 2

All applicants must meet a number of stringent criteria. The competition is open to girls aged 17 to 24 years with a height of 172 cm. Contestants must not be married, and children are not allowed. A prerequisite is knowledge of at least one foreign language.

Step 3

A special commission checks the portfolios of the girls, their purpose is not only to certify the compliance of the contestants with the parameters, but also to certify that there are no nude photo shoots before and after the competition under the threat of being stripped of their title.

Step 4

During the tests, talents, communication skills, personal qualities and the level of intelligence are assessed. Usually the competition is held in two formats: an official stage and an unofficial one, which is called an "after-party". Numerous parties, receptions and meetings, at which all participants are required to attend, are held in order to cover the financial costs of the event, as well as to assess the girls' ability to behave in public. Such an assessment does not appear in the assessment table, but it is very important, because the factor of subjective perception also has a significant influence on decision-making.

Step 5

The winner of the competition receives a cash prize, which she is obliged to donate to charity, and also signs a contract for a year, according to which she undertakes to use her title and appearance only in accordance with the orders of the organizers of the competition and to conduct charitable activities.
